Geezer wrote:I’m your same weight. When I was learning I started on a 9’3”x23”x3” longboard. I managed to break my cherry on that and learned to go left and right and do cutbacks both ways. I felt I wanted a smaller board so I could surf more dynamically and git a 7’6” mini mal. I was awful on that and struggled for a few months until I decided to get another 9’ longboard. Once I did my surfing progressed and a year and a half later when I did get a smaller board I was then ready for that challenge.
oldmansurfer wrote:I am guessing the 7,2" Surf Series didn't fit in your car? And it limited your ability to ride waves? I seriously doubt you're going to find a board that fits in your car and doesn't limit your ability to ride not to mention you pretty much rule out a longboard which you say is what you want to ride. I guess if you're set on that then get a board with a continuous rocker and has a wide nose and tail and is as wide as you can get your arms around to paddle on. However I think you should just get a longboard and strap it to your car
